Human Nova would work fine for end game content. Just take Boxing, Kick, and Cross Punch and slot those like you would the Dwarf melee so you still have those sets. Most builds already have a pretty well optimized Nova form so you probably wouldn't use that many of those additional slots in that. You could spread those additional slots to Weave or shields. If you plan to play the game content solo to level instead of power leveling or farming, you'll pretty much need to do Tri-Form to 50 first. Nova gets really soft by the late teen levels and you don't get any significant resistance without Dwarf until light form at 38.

It's doable, but with a big caveat;  If you want to be effective, you are going to have to drop to human form periodically to apply buffs or heals, such as hasten or perhaps victory rush or other such click-powers that carry over to nova form.  If you don't, then  as @Hyperstrike pointed out, you'd basically be a less powerful blaster with far fewer powers at your disposal...

People do go through that with Kheldians. You get Nova, and suddenly you're the invincible map clearing squidlord thinking "This is the life, man!! I could do this all day!!!" ...until about level 15 when you go into a room with your tentacles blazing and all of the sudden you're faceplanted. A couple of hospital trips later you realize things can now hurt you easily. Then you either start being a lot more cautious or team your way to 20 when you can get that delicious Dwarf safety net that hits like a wet towel for the next 6 levels. Then you're just struggling to 38 to get that Light form

Never leaving Nova?  Can see that happening.  i wouldnt tho

Using human form for utility clicks/travel/nuke and maybe Solar flare?  thats what i do.

 

I do spent a lot of my time in Nova form just to blast shit and switching to human to heal/buff/etc.

 

Random protip:  the tilde key ` is next to the 1 and Tab keys

/bind ` "powexecname Bright Nova"

this binds Nova form to tilde and offers quick transformations
